SoFi [SOFI] supply has actually had a rough flight considering that it concerned market in June 2021 by combining with Social Funding Hedosophia Holdings, a blank-check firm run by equity capital capitalist as well as very early Facebook staff member Chamath Palihapitiya.
SoFi, brief for Social Financing, formerly traded under the ticker IPOE for Palihapitiya’s unique objective lorry. Its share cost has actually dropped 51% considering that the start of June 2021 to shut at $9.87 on 9 March.
Established In 2011 with a concentrate on trainee lending refinancing for millennials, the fintech firm has actually significantly increased its item supplying to consist of individual lendings, bank card, home mortgages, financial investment accounts, financial solutions as well as economic preparation.
SoFi has actually been including substantial resources of brand-new income, as well as with each brand-new item has actually boosted its overall addressable market. The fintech company’s objective is to come to be an all-in-one individual financing system.
In April 2020 it acquired Galileo for $1.2bn in money as well as supply, which increased its repayment as well as account solutions for debit cards as well as electronic financial. SoFi acquired governing authorization to come to be a nationwide financial institution in January, an essential turning point that must assist the individual financing company get to even more clients as well as more expand its income streams.SOFI Graph by TradingView
Technisys procurement falls short to raise the SoFi share cost
SoFi introduced on 3 March that it had actually finished its procurement of electronic multi-product core financial system Technisys in an all-stock offer worth $1.1bn.
“Technisys is a necessary foundation in providing on our member-centric, electronic one-stop-shop experience for SoFi participants as well as our companions with Galileo, our service provider of fintech cloud solutions,” claimed Anthony Noto (imagined over), Chief Executive Officer of SoFi, in a declaration.
The fintech company anticipates the procurement will certainly include in SoFi’s income development, as well as thinks the mixed firms can much better offer Galileo’s 100 million consumer accounts as well as Technisys’ greater than 60 developed financial institution, fintech as well as non-financial brand names in Latin America as well as the United States.
SoFi claimed in its declaration that the approximated step-by-step income from the acquisition, consisting of base income of Technisys as well as income harmonies of the up and down incorporated abilities, is anticipated to include a total amount of $500–800m with year-end 2025, at high step-by-step margins.
It likewise approximates the change as well as the upright assimilation with Galileo will certainly develop about $75–85m in overall expense financial savings from 2023 to 2025 as well as $60–70m every year afterwards.
SoFi supply rises on Q4 numbers
The SoFi supply cost skyrocketed 16% after hrs complying with the launch of its fourth-quarter outcomes on 1 March. The electronic economic solutions firm published a quarterly loss of $0.15 per share, which was narrower than the agreement price quote of a $0.17 loss, while income was available in at $279.9m, a little defeating quotes of $279.3m.
“We struck brand-new highs throughout our essential economic as well as running metrics in the 4th quarter, completing 2021 with record yearly outcomes,” Noto claimed after the statement.
The firm completed 2021 with 3.5 million overall participants, up 87% from the beginning of the year as well as virtually 500,000 in advance of its mentioned objective. Throughout the 4th quarter it included a document 523,000 brand-new participants, a brand-new high in outright terms, up 39% from the variety of web includes the 3rd quarter.
When penetrated by experts throughout its revenues phone call, the firm claimed it would certainly not offer details section or product-level assistance for 2022. SoFi currently anticipates to produce $280–285m of modified web income in the initial quarter of 2022, up 30–32% year-over-year. It likewise anticipates that readjusted web income will certainly expand 55% year-over-year in 2022 to $1.57bn.

Morgan Stanley is still favorable on the SoFi share cost
In January, experts at Morgan Stanley claimed that SoFi’s thumbs-up from the regulatory authority to introduce an across the country hired financial institution was an action that would certainly drive large advantage for the supply.
At the time the financial investment financial institution claimed it saw a base instance cost target of $20 for SoFi supply, showing a prospective uplift of 102.6%. It discussed that the governing authorization offers the firm 3 courses to productivity.
The initial includes supplying even more affordable down payment items as well as across the country loaning, while the 2nd course would certainly involve bring in brand-new clients as well as broadening the channel for future cross-buying. SoFi’s 3rd alternative would certainly be to broaden web passion revenue as lendings will certainly be held much longer.
Complying with the fintech company’s fourth-quarter outcomes, Morgan Stanley kept its ‘obese’ score on SoFi supply yet minimized its cost target from $20 to $18, standing for a prospective advantage of 82.3% from the present degree.
